As I stated in the announcement, I'll do my best to help you all out. I'll address a few that I've seen as I've meandered through the boards right now. 1.) Replying to messages.There is a quick reply at the bottom of the thread, however, once you've opened the thread and would like to reply and have a normal reply screen, there is a reply button that appears in the blue header at the top of the first post on each page. You can also quote certain posts by clicking the quote button that appears on the post of the person that you'd like to quote. 2.) How do I post pictures?I personally prefer using an image host such as Photobucket, you can set up a free account upload your pictures to Photobucket and actually resize the pitures as you upload them by the options on the upload screen, and then post the image tag (which appears as "[ img ]" image url "[ / img ]" minus the quotation marks and spaces) on our forums. Photobucket has options under each uploaded picture with different ways to post them, either with an URL which will just be a link that links back to that picture, or with the img tag it will actually post the picture in the thread. There are also ways to post a lot of photos at once. The plus side of using an image host is that it saves our bandwidth as well...
